When you narrow down the aperture of your lens to settings like f/18 or smaller, diffraction becomes the primary issue that leads to image distortion. Diffraction is a physical phenomenon caused by light bending around the edges of the aperture blades within the lens. As the aperture becomes smaller, the amount of bending increases, causing the light rays to interfere with each other and spread out more. This spreading reduces the sharpness and detail in the image, manifesting as a general softening or blurring that some might perceive as distortion.
